What is web application development?

Web application development is the process of creating software applications that run on web servers and can be accessed through a web browser. It involves designing, building, testing, and maintaining applications that use technologies such as H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and server-side languages like Python, PHP, or Java. Web apps can range from simple websites to complex platforms like e-commerce sites or online tools. The goal is to deliver interactive, user-friendly experiences that work across multiple devices and browsers.

How do web application developers typically collaborate with designers and backend engineers during a project?

Web application developers frequently work closely with both UI/UX designers and backend engineers to ensure seamless integration of frontend interfaces with server-side logic. Collaboration often involves regular meetings, shared project management tools, and code reviews to align on functionality and design requirements. Developers may participate in sprint planning sessions and use platforms like GitHub for version control, facilitating smooth communication and efficient handoffs between teams. This collaborative environment helps ensure the final product is user-friendly, visually appealing, and performs reliably across different devices.

What is the difference between Web Application Development vs Web Software Development?

AspectWeb Application DevelopmentWeb Software Development
FocusBuilding interactive, user-facing web applicationsCreating software solutions that run on web platforms, including backend and frontend
SkillsHTML, CSS, JavaScript, frameworks like React or AngularSame as Web Application Development, often including server-side languages like PHP, Python, or Java
Work EnvironmentWeb development teams, client projects, startupsSoftware companies, enterprise solutions, SaaS providers

Web Application Development primarily focuses on creating interactive web apps for users, while Web Software Development encompasses a broader range of web-based software solutions, including backend systems. Both roles share similar skills and work environments, but their scope and end goals differ slightly.
